Recovery
Matrices listed below were spiked with certain level of recombinant Lecithin Cholesterol Acyltransferase (LCAT) ,etc. by CBA (Cytometric Bead Array) and the recovery rates were calculated by comparing the measured value to the expected amount of Lecithin Cholesterol Acyltransferase (LCAT) ,etc. by CBA (Cytometric Bead Array) in samples.
| Matrix | Recovery range (%) | Average(%) |
| serum(n=5) | 97-105 | 102 |
| EDTA plasma(n=5) | 78-104 | 85 |
| heparin plasma(n=5) | 90-102 | 95 |
Precision
Intra-assay Precision (Precision within an assay): 3 samples with low, middle and high level Lecithin Cholesterol Acyltransferase (LCAT) ,etc. by CBA (Cytometric Bead Array) were tested 20 times on one plate, respectively.
Inter-assay Precision (Precision between assays): 3 samples with low, middle and high level Lecithin Cholesterol Acyltransferase (LCAT) ,etc. by CBA (Cytometric Bead Array) were tested on 3 different plates, 8 replicates in each plate.
CV(%) = SD/meanX100
Intra-Assay: CV<10%
Inter-Assay: CV<12%
Linearity
The linearity of the kit was assayed by testing samples spiked with appropriate concentration of Lecithin Cholesterol Acyltransferase (LCAT) ,etc. by CBA (Cytometric Bead Array) and their serial dilutions. The results were demonstrated by the percentage of calculated concentration to the expected.
| Sample | 1:2 | 1:4 | 1:8 | 1:16 |
| serum(n=5) | 89-97% | 87-99% | 92-105% | 82-92% |
| EDTA plasma(n=5) | 80-91% | 81-96% | 93-104% | 78-95% |
| heparin plasma(n=5) | 94-102% | 86-97% | 90-98% | 96-103% |

Assay procedure summary
1. Add 200μL analysis buffer solution to each well of the plate for pre-wetting;
2. Preparation of standards, reagents and samples before the experiment;
3. Add 100μL standard or sample to each well, add 10μL magnetic beads, and incubate 120 minutes protect from light at 25°C on shaker;
4. Remove liquid on magnetic frame, add 100μL prepared Detection Reagent A. Incubate 60 minutes protect from light at 25°C on shaker;
5. Remove liquid on magnetic frame, add 100μL prepared Detection Reagent B, and incubate 30 minutes protect from light at 25°C on shaker;
6. Wash plate once on magnetic frame;
7. Add 100μL sheath fluid, swirl for 10 minutes, read on the machine.
